Accident summary

On Monday 20 November 2006 at 18:58 a slight collision occurred near A 6076 involving 1 vehicle (motorcycle 125cc and under) and 1 casualty (1 slight) Weather at the time was recorded as raining no high winds. Road surface conditions were wet or damp. Lighting was described as darkness - lights lit. A police officer attended the scene.
